Transaction 7cec26b346e22057cc50c5d18a0cdeee2f8afcaecf94364010f54c1961718839

1 Input
2 Outputs
  • 7cec26b346e22057cc50c5d18a0cdeee2f8afcaecf94364010f54c1961718839:0
  • value  141000000
    address  379WxKtvN8Y3M2vT9jV6aNbDdRNVurqLLK
  • 7cec26b346e22057cc50c5d18a0cdeee2f8afcaecf94364010f54c1961718839:1
  • value  58941818
    address  3LP8avaLDJS7Ku8WVSY2gfiVM8moNwTmJm